A dedicated MedTech Capital Fund has been launched through a strategic partnership between Andhra Pradesh MedTech Zone (AMTZ), Visakhapatnam, and MedArtha Capital to support the growth of India’s medical technology sector.

The platform was officially unveiled by Union Minister for Commerce and Industry Piyush Goyal at a programme in Mumbai on March 15, according to an official release.

The initiative aims to provide growth capital and strategic support to emerging medical device companies, enabling start-ups to expand research, innovation, and manufacturing capabilities in India.

Jitendra Sharma, Founder, Managing Director and CEO of AMTZ, said the fund will help scale innovations developed by Indian entrepreneurs and position the country as a global leader in medical technology through strong engineering and cost-efficient manufacturing.

Ganesh Sabat, Managing Partner at MedArtha Capital, said the operator-led platform will work closely with entrepreneurs and leverage specialized infrastructure at AMTZ to build globally competitive MedTech companies.
